>> I have moved ahead with implementing this based on the design I
>> described above and have pushed my in progress work to my fork on
>> GitHub (https://github.com/kbaltrinic/rhino-queues/tree/perf-counters)
>> for review.  Currently I have a few concerns.
>>
>> 1) I am currently initializing performance counters by a call to
>> QueueManager.EnablePerformanceCounters(...);  Since this call is made
>> after the manager is constructed, send and receive operations are
>> already in progress and there are thus threading concerns with the
>> PerformanceMonitor.SyncWithCurrentQueueState() method as its trying to
>> hit a moving target.  I would like to hear some ideas on what people
>> think may be the best way to solve this.  I think my favorite option
>> is to add a override to QueueManager constructor that takes a new
>> "ConfigurationData" object that can be used to pass in configuration
>> information.  This way, if preformance  motinoring is desired, it can
>> start up before the send and receive threads do.  Another option is to
>> add a Start method to the QueueManager and not start the
>> automatically, but that is a breaking change, unless we add a
>> autostart switch to the constructor that defaults to true.  Third is
>> some means of thread synchronization.
>>
>> 2) The integration tests in the
>> Rhino.Queues.Tests.Monitoring.EnablingPerformanceCounters fixture
>> required admin rights in order to work as only admin accounts can
>> create and delete Perf Counter Categories.  I am not sure how that
>> requirement should be handled in the context of this project.
>>
>> 3) The MessageQueuedForReceive_EventNotRaised_IfReceiveAborts test in
>> the Rhino.Queues.Tests.RaisingReceivedEvents fixture is currently set
>> to skip because, other than coding a throw statement into the Sender
>> class and removing it after the test, I can't figure out a set up the
>> needed conditions for this test.
>>
>> Lastly, the final piece of this implementation that I have yet to
>> tackle is setting up the PerformanceMonitor class so that it
>> participates in transactions.  Currently for example, if a message is
>> sent, the Unsent Messages counter gets incremented immediately and
>> does not decrement if the tx rolls back.   Same thing for Receive,
>> MoveTo and EnqueueDirectlyTo actions.  I have a pretty good idea of
>> how I intend to handle this.  Just throwing it out there as an FYI of
>> work yet to be done.
